Biography of Kathy Bates

Kathy Bates was born on June 28, 1948, in Memphis, Tennessee. She grew up in a family that valued the arts, with her mother being a talented pianist. Kathy developed an interest in acting at a young age, leading her to pursue a career in the performing arts. After attending the University of Tennessee, she moved to New York City to further her acting career.

Early Life and Education

Kathy Bates attended White Station High School in Memphis, where she began acting in school plays. She later enrolled at the University of Tennessee, where she earned a Bachelor of Arts in Theater. After graduation, Bates moved to New York City, where she worked in various theater productions, honing her craft and establishing herself as a serious actress.

Career Highlights

Bates' breakthrough role came in the 1990 film "Misery," where she portrayed Annie Wilkes, a deranged fan who holds her favorite author captive. This performance earned her an Academy Award for Best Actress and brought her international acclaim.

Throughout her career, Bates has appeared in numerous films and television shows, showcasing her versatility and range as an actress. Some of her notable works include:

  • “About Schmidt” (2002)
  • “The Blind Side” (2009)
  • “American Horror Story” (2013 - Present)
  • “Richard Jewell” (2019)
